About this event
Baylor TIP Camp is primarily residential, but families may select a day camp option. Students will stay in the dorms with Resident Assistants Sunday night through Friday nights, going home Saturday morning. Course offerings will run from 9am to 4pm, and social events and activities will be held every evening. Meals are included with registration. Students who elect to commute to camp will have the option of participating in the breakfast and staying for evening activities if they choose. Students must have been admitted to Baylor TIP to enroll. Curating the Past: Rare Books & Hidden Histories What if you got to decide how history is remembered and present your ideas to the world like a pro? In this hands-on course, you will become curators, working with rare books, letters, and artifacts from university libraries to design an original special collections exhibit. Dig into hidden stories, uncover secrets in primary sources, and decide how to make the past speak to a modern audience. You’ll tackle interactive challenges, visit libraries, and learn insider techniques from professionals. The course culminates in a pitch to a mock museum board, where you will work in teams to defend your exhibit and respond to questions. Throughout the process, you will sharpen transferable skills used in fields like law, journalism, marketing, UX design, business, and STEM: research, critical analysis, collaboration, storytelling, and confident presentation. If you like discovering hidden stories and turning ideas into something tangible, this course puts you in charge of the narrative. Level: TIP Lyceum
